Default Prompt for document properties Save opion fails to prompt

The "Prompt for document properties" option on the Save Options tab is
enabled. Word does NOT prompt for document properties when file saves are
executed.

Default Prompt for document properties Save opion fails to prompt

You are prompted for document properties only the first time you save a
document, before you have named it. If you use Save As to save under a
different name a document that has already been saved and named, you are not
prompted. Although I find this annoying, I can only imagine that the
decision not to prompt was based on requests from users who save multiple
versions of a file for security purposes and didn't want to be prompted for
each daily update.
